Transaction d82e509a989ae84aadee09bfa9114c01fd4756e4f50eb3a672aaab8830126f32
1 Input
1 Output
-
d82e509a989ae84aadee09bfa9114c01fd4756e4f50eb3a672aaab8830126f32:0
- value
- 13094568
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89a84d9a4b673c23fabbe12a9ecd6c03036cc0f5 OP_EQUAL
- address
- 3EEt7jNejtt4Ng2M4NPMdpp36cDg39S78P